Sandbags To Hold Down Gazebo. You should also remove any loose items from the gazebo, such as umbrellas and cushions, to prevent them from becoming wind hazards. If you must use a gazebo in fairly windy conditions, make sure to stake it down securely and use weights to hold down gazebos, sandbags or water barrels to anchor it down. When filled with sand, rock, gravel, snow, and dirt, each sandbag can hold up to 37.5 lbs of weight; One option is to use sandbags or weights to hold down the gazebo legs. With four sandbags you will have 150 lbs of weight to support your gazebo.
